  • A system for measuring the electrodermal activity (EDA) signal occurring at the sweat glands in the left palm and left finger of the human body was implemented in this study. The EDA measurement system (EDAMS) consisted of an algometer, a biopotential measurement system (BPMS), and a PC. Two experiments were performed to evaluate the function and clinical applicability of EDAMS. First, an experiment was carried out on the linearity of the voltage and the pressure that comprised the output signals of the algometer used for applying a pressure stimulus. Second, the amplitude of the EDA signal acquired from the electrode attached to the left palm or finger was measured while increasing the pressure stimulus of the algometer. When the pressure stimulus of the algometer applied to the left scapula was increased, the amplitude of the EDA signal increased. The amplitude of the EDA signal at the left palm was observed to be greater than that at the left finger. The amplitude of the EDA signal was observed to increase in a relatively linear relation with the intensity of the pressure stimuli. In addition, the latency of the EDA signal acquired from the electrode attached to the left palm or finger was measured while increasing the pressure stimulus of the algometer. When the pressure stimulus of the algometer applied to the left scapula was increased, the latency of the EDA signal decreased. The latency of the EDA signal at the palm was observed to be less than that at the finger. The latency of the EDA signal was observed to decrease nonlinearly with the pressure stimuli.

  • Electrodermal activity(EDA) is a bio-electric signal which occurs at the skin surface during the sweating. EDA reflects the activity of the sympathetic axis of the autonomic nervous system. EDA is associated with the eccrine sweat gland at the palmar and plamar surface. This study was aimed to characterize the relationship between EDA and auditory stimulus intensities. Acoustic stimulus used in this study were 500 Hz, 1 kHz, 2 kHz of narrow band noise, which were representative of speech frequencies in audible range. Stimulus intensity between 90 and 30 dB in 10 dB within dynamic range. After deriving the minimum stimulus intensity(threshold of skin potential) which elicited skin potential, and then the latency and amplitude were derived from waveform of skin potential, each latency and amplitude were compared to stimulus intensity. The waveform of skin potential were recorded stably, and the threshold of skin potential appeared nearly the hearing threshold level of the participant. The latency was decreased and the amplitude was increased according to the increase of the stimulus intensity. These results suggest that auditory evoked skin potential can be applicable to auditory assessment and audiological diagnosis tool.

  • Although many studies have analyzed the relationship between electrodermal activity (EDA) and sleep stages, a practical method for detecting sleep stage using EDA has not been suggested. The aim of this study was to develop an algorithm for real-time automatic detection of deep sleep using the EDA signal. Simultaneously with overnight polysomnography (PSG), continuous measurement of skin conductance on the fingers was performed for ten subjects. The morphometric characteristics in the fluctuations of EDA signal were employed to establish the quantitative criteria for determining deep sleep. The 30-sec epoch-by-epoch comparison between the deep sleep detected by our method and that reported from PSG exhibited an average sensitivity of 74.6%, an average specificity of 98.0%, and an average accuracy of 96.1%. This study may address the growing need for a reliable and simple measure for identifying sleep stage without a PSG.

  • Due to rapid urbanization and population growth, it has become crucial to analyze the various volumes and characteristics of pedestrian pathways to understand the capacity and level of service (LOS) for pathways to promote a better walking environment. Different indicators have been developed to measure pedestrian volume. The pedestrian level of service (PLOS), tailored to analyze pedestrian pathways based on the concept of the LOS in transportation in the Highway Capacity Manual, has been widely used. PLOS is a measurement concept used to assess the quality of pedestrian facilities, from grade A (best condition) to grade F (worst condition), based on the flow rate, average speed, occupied space, and other parameters. Since the original PLOS approach has been criticized for producing idealistic results, several modified versions of PLOS have also been developed. One of these modified versions is perceived PLOS, which measures the LOS for pathways by considering pedestrians' awareness levels. However, this method relies on survey-based measurements, making it difficult to continuously deploy the technique to all the pathways. To measure PLOS more quantitatively and continuously, researchers have adopted computer vision technologies to automatically assess pedestrian flows and PLOS from CCTV videos. However, there are drawbacks even with this method because CCTVs cannot be installed everywhere, e.g., in alleyways. Recently, a technique to monitor bio-signals, such as electrodermal activity (EDA), through wearable sensors that can measure physiological responses to external stimuli (e.g., when another pedestrian passes), has gained popularity. It has the potential to continuously measure perceived PLOS. In their previous experiment, the authors of this study found that there were many significant EDA responses in crowded places when other pedestrians acting as external stimuli passed by. Therefore, we hypothesized that the EDA responses would be significantly higher in places where relatively more dynamic objects pass, i.e., in crowded areas with low PLOS levels (e.g., level F). To this end, the authors conducted an experiment to confirm the validity of EDA in inferring the perceived PLOS. The EDA of the subjects was measured and analyzed while watching both the real-world and virtually created videos with different pedestrian volumes in a laboratory environment. The results showed the possibility of inferring the amount of pedestrian volume on the pathways by measuring the physiological reactions of pedestrians. Through further validation, the research outcome is expected to be used for EDA-based continuous measurement of perceived PLOS at the alley level, which will facilitate modifying the existing walking environments, e.g., constructing pathways with appropriate effective width based on pedestrian volume. Future research will examine the validity of the integrated use of EDA and acceleration signals to increase the accuracy of inferring the perceived PLOS by capturing both physiological and behavioral reactions when walking in a crowded area.

  • Background and purpose: Bell‘s Palsy is a condition that causes the facial muscles to weaken or become paralyzed. It's caused by trauma to the 7th cranial nerve, and is not permanent. The aim of this study is to be convinced of differences between facial electrodermal activities of paralyzed side and those of normal side in acute stage of Bell's Palsy patients Methods: Electrodermal activity (EDA) was performed within 1 week after the onset of facial palsy and facial nerve electromyography (EMG) at 2 weeks after the onset. The recovery of facial nerve function was documented by House and Brackmann grading. All the patients were followed up weekly until recovery or up to 6 weeks. Results: There was significant differences (conductivity A: t=3.319, p=0.002; conductivity C: t=2.699, p=0.010) between facial electrodermal conductivities of paralyzed side and those of normal side in acute stage of Bell's Palsy patients (N=45). And the result showed that logarithmic scale of electrodermal conductivity A value ratio obviousely decreased with logarithmic scale of EMG zygomatic branch amplitude ratio (r=-0.472, p=0.143); logarithmic scale of capacitance B, logarithmic scale of EMG temporal branch amplitude ratio (r=-0.422, p=0.133); logarithmic scale of conductivity C, logarithmic scale of EMG buccal branch amplitude ratio (r=-0.545, p=0.083) (N=12). Conclusion: Electrodermal conductivities increased in paralyzed facial side in acute stage of Bell's Palsy patients.

  • This paper studies the arousal effects of aroma and warning sound using EDA(Electrodermal Activity:EDA), Aroma stimulus started at Nz value over 1.2. Warning sound was prepared according to the arousal evaluation and control criteria. As a result, the warning sound could be controlled the arousal level in all the mKSS state. Aroma stimulus was able to prevent drowsy more than warning sound in the mKSS 3 state(the first stage of drowsiness). Therefor, aroma stimulus was can be used for arousal control at that state. Futhermore, arousal control was shown to be more effective with presentation of both aroma and warning sounds than each presentation.

  • 인간의 생체 신호 데이터가 인간의 상태를 가장 잘 설명할 수 있다 할지라도 실제 운전 중에 운전자의 생체 데이터를 얻어 운전자의 상태를 판단하는 일은 쉽지 않다. 본 논문에서는 이러한 한계를 극복하기 위한 방법 중 하나로 운전자의 주행 정보를 이용한 운전자 스트레스 모니터링 시스템을 제안한다. 운전자의 주행 정보는 OBD-II 스캐너를 통해 취득하고, 실제 운전자의 운전 스트레스 여부는 E4 밴드를 통해 취득한 EDA 데이터를 이용하여 판단한다. 스트레스 감지 모델은 MLP 신경망 모델을 사용하였으며 약 한 달 간의 운행 데이터를 이용하여 학습시켰다. 제안한 시스템을 평가하기 위하여 약 1시간의 운행 데이터를 사용하였고 약 92%의 정확도를 얻을 수 있었다.

  • 본 연구에서는 피부전기활동을 이용한 졸음 검출시 발생되는 동잡음 제거법을 제안하였다. 운전 조작시 발생하는 동잡음을 제거할 수 없는 기존의 핸들형 전극의 문제점을 해결하기 위하여 두 종류의 손목형 전극을 개발하였으며, 세 종류의 전극을 비교 실험한 결과, type I 전극을 개선한 손목형 전극 II가 동잡음 제거에 가장 효과적이었다. 가상 운전 실험을 통하여 동잡음 판별기준(IRI$\leq$10과 1.1$\leq$dNz)을 설정하고 이 기준을 동시에 만족하는 경우의 Nz값을 동잡음 발생이전의 Nz값으로서 치환하는 동잡음 제거 알고리즘을 개발하였다. 가상 및 도로 주행 실험결과 제안된 알고리즘은 동잡을 성공적으로 제거할 수 있었으며, 본 연구에서 제안된 알고리즘의 개선된 전극을 이용하여 구현된 시스템은 동일한 영향을 받지 않고 각성상태를 정확히 측정할 수 있음을 확인하였다.
